Knitting Elegant Textured Herringbone Washcloth Free Pattern

Materials Needed:

  • Worsted weight cotton yarn in beige
  • Size US 7 (4.5 mm) knitting needles
  • Tapestry needle for weaving in ends

Gauge:

20 stitches x 26 rows = 4 inches in pattern

Finished Size:

Approximately 10 x 10 inches

Instructions:

Cast On

Cast on 50 stitches.

Border

Work in garter stitch (knit every row) for 6 rows.

Main Pattern

  1. Row 1 (RS): Knit 5 for edge, *k2, slip 1 with yarn in front*, repeat from * to last 5 stitches, knit 5.
  2. Row 2 (WS): Knit 5 for edge, *purl 2, slip 1 with yarn in back*, repeat from * to last 5 stitches, knit 5.
  3. Row 3: Knit 5 for edge, *slip 1 with yarn in back, k2*, repeat from * to last 5 stitches, knit 5.
  4. Row 4: Knit 5 for edge, *slip 1 with yarn in front, p2*, repeat from * to last 5 stitches, knit 5.

Repeat Rows 1-4 until your piece measures 9 inches from the cast-on edge.

Border

Work in garter stitch for 6 rows.

Bind Off

Bind off all stitches loosely. Weave in all ends using the tapestry needle.

Finishing:

Block to measurements for an even finish.
